Buying Guide

Choose the right surface

Vellum (toothy) is better for graphite and charcoal, while smooth plate bristol suits ink, markers, and fine pen work

Match weight to medium

Heavier weights or 2‑ply bristol resist buckling with wet media and heavy ink, while lightweight sheets work well for dry media and tracing

Consider sheet count

Larger packs reduce cost per sheet and are useful for practice or projects with many drafts, while pads and smaller packs are convenient for sketching

Check size and format

Pick standard sizes like 8.5x11 or 11x14 to fit frames, printers, and common workspaces without trimming

Look for archival properties

Acid-free and archival-rated bristol helps artwork resist yellowing and last longer when framing or storing
